We have configured Kerberos for Windows Authentication for EP 7.0.
The authentication works fine when we use the server name alone, but it fails when we use the FQDN.

When you register the Service Principal Name on the LDAP, Please make sure that you register it with your FQDN.

When I added the server name with the full domain in the security zone of the local intranet in the client browser it worked fine.
Do we have an option to solve this from the server side itself.
I guess it would not be feasible to make the change in all the client systems.
